Document: Peace Conference Agenda

Description: The agenda for the Peace Conference for the 21st Century. The text is within a double black frame. A PDF of the original document is reproduced below.

PEACE CONFERENCE
for the
21st Century

ON THE EVE OF U.N. HUMAN RIGHTS DAY

7-8:30pm
Thursday, December 9th
Beems Auditorium
Downtown Cedar Rapids Public Library

Guest Panelists

Jonna Higgins-Freese
Distinctions: Environmental Outreach Coordinator, Prairewoods
Theme: “Peace on Earth: The Environmental Connection to Peace and Justice”

Betty Daniels
Distinctions: Miss Black Cedar Rapids for the year 1970
Theme: How to Better Weave Arts into Education

Marcelino Hivento
Distinctions: Immigrant from Bolivia, Chairman of Latin American Assoc., Children & Youth Activist, Believer in Diversity
Theme: “Obstacles to Peace”

Ingrid Wehrle-Ray
Distinction: Artist and a Mother of Two
Theme: “No Boxes, Please.”

Jim Jones
Distinction: Area High School Spanish Teacher
Theme: “Baha’i Approach to Peace”

Followed by an open discussion with the audience.
Delicious refreshments provided.

The Baha’i Speakers Forum is taking on this format of Peace Conferences for the next several years
